Cessna Citation CJ4 specifications

Manufacturer figures for the Cessna Citation CJ4Light class.

Range2,165 nm · 2,491 statute miles
Max cruiseMach 0.77 / 451 kts
Service ceiling45,000 ft
Passengers7 typical · 10 max
Crew1
Fuel burn130 gal/hr · median across tracked airframes
Engines2× Williams FJ44-4A (3,621 lbf each)
MTOW17,110 lb
Cabin17.3 × 4.8 × 4.8 ft · length × width × height
Entered service2010

What a Cessna Citation CJ4 costs

Indicative mid-2026 market figures. Approximate — not an appraisal of any individual aircraft.

New, list price

$12 million

before options and completion

Pre-owned, typical ask

$6–10 million

varies with hours and engine programme

Variable cost per hour

$1,700–2,500

fuel, maintenance reserves, crew trip costs

Operating a Cessna Citation CJ4 costs approximately $1,700–2,500 per flight hour in variable costs — fuel, maintenance reserves, engine programme and crew trip expenses. Fuel alone accounts for roughly $845 of that: 130 gallons of Jet-A an hour at $6.50 a gallon. Fixed ownership costs (hangarage, insurance, salaried crew, depreciation) sit on top and roughly double the annual bill.

Acquisition prices are manufacturer list prices for models still in production and typical pre-owned asking ranges otherwise. Hourly figures are variable direct operating cost only; fixed ownership costs are excluded.

How far can a Cessna Citation CJ4 fly?

A Cessna Citation CJ4 has a published range of 2,165 nautical miles (about 2,491 statute miles), cruising at Mach 0.77 / 451 kts with a service ceiling of 45,000 ft. Range figures are manufacturer NBAA IFR numbers with a typical passenger load; real-world range falls with headwinds, a full cabin and hot-and-high departures.
